Hockenson's the most well-rounded TE prospect to come out in some time.

You are correct that Vance can be one of the best when healthy, but if he's not healthy (and that's been the case a lot so far in his career), then we have Xavier Grimble and Bucky Hodges right now. If we are able to add Hockenson, we can use Vance and Hock in tandem in 2 TE sets, as opposed to the 3 WR sets that were commonplace during the AB era. Both can block as well as catch passes, so our run game and pass game would benefit. With Vance, Hock, Juju, Moncrief, and Conner in the game, we could be either smashmouth or aerial without needing to sub in different personnel, and we can benefit from the defense not being able to switch into their sub packages.

Once upon a time, Heath Miller surprisingly fell to us, and it was a godsend as we won a Super Bowl in his rookie season. I would be quite satisfied if history repeated itself.

Fant is more a Jimmy Graham type of TE, while Hockenson is more a Heath Miller type of TE.

Different teams looks for different attributes in their TE's, so I'm not surprised that some teams like Fant more.

But for the Steelers, I prefer Hockenson. Fant is a heck of a player in his own right, though.
